What they do

An Animal Care Worker or Manager manages animal care and grooming for a retail store that sells pets or for a pet grooming business. May also provide animal care and grooming at a kennel. Works with animals in shelters or rescue organizations. Works primarily with dogs and cats. Assists veterinarians with vaccinations or other procedures; screens people who want to adopt an animal from a shelter and provides information about caring for animals.

Job Description

Job description: Woof's is now hiring energetic and fun-loving people who enjoy working with animals. Pack Leaders can bring up to 2 dogs for FREE DayPlay when they're on duty. You'll work with friendly teammates in a supportive, happy, work environment. Part-Time and full-time hours are available! Must be at least 18 years old with reliable transportation and have Weekend Availability. Pay & Perks Pay Raises every 90 days! Development opportunities with Woof's Free DayPlay for your dogs while working Full-time employees are eligible for benefits (Health, Dental & Vision) after 60 days. 401(K) retirement plan & company match for employees 21 and older. Discounts at other doggie brands under the Woof's umbrella. Duties & Responsibilities Ability to work while continuously on your feet showing the dogs attention and care Proactively address behavior in a timely manner with approved methods. Woof's has zero-tolerance for mishandling of animals or using non-approved animal management methods Continually monitor dogs and keep the play areas free of messes by continual spot cleaning throughout the shift Follow standard cleaning procedures including proper use of chemicals to ensure a safe environment for animals and people Understand and follow the feeding, medication, and allergy lists to ensure that all health standards are met consistently Work cohesively and respectfully with your teammates Maintain a positive attitude and demeanor in all aspects of your position including room management and customer service Qualifications Dog or animal experience preferred, but not required Customer service experience preferred, but not required Ability to stand for up to 8 hours and bend repetitively Ability to lift and carry dogs and equipment weighing up to 40 lbs. Availability to work some weekends and holidays.
